Skip to content
This repository was archived by the owner on Feb 27, 2024. It is now read-only.

Upgrade to wasmtime 10#10

Merged
rylev merged 7 commits intomainfrom
wasmtime10
Jun 21, 2023
Merged

Upgrade to wasmtime 10#10
rylev merged 7 commits intomainfrom
wasmtime10

Conversation

@rylev
Copy link
Contributor

@rylev rylev commented Jun 14, 2023

This upgrades spin-componentize to wasmtime 10.0. We'll leave this in draft mode until wasmtime 10.0 is officially released and we can decide whether it's the right time to merge this.

rylev added 4 commits June 15, 2023 18:14
Signed-off-by: Ryan Levick <ryan.levick@fermyon.com>
Signed-off-by: Ryan Levick <ryan.levick@fermyon.com>
Signed-off-by: Ryan Levick <ryan.levick@fermyon.com>
Signed-off-by: Ryan Levick <ryan.levick@fermyon.com>
Signed-off-by: Ryan Levick <ryan.levick@fermyon.com>
Signed-off-by: Ryan Levick <ryan.levick@fermyon.com>
@rylev rylev marked this pull request as ready for review June 20, 2023 15:52
@rylev rylev requested a review from dicej June 20, 2023 15:52
@rylev
Copy link
Contributor Author

rylev commented Jun 20, 2023

wasmtime 10.0.0 has been released, so I'm opening this up for review.

Signed-off-by: Ryan Levick <ryan.levick@fermyon.com>
Copy link
Collaborator

@dicej dicej left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good overall. Just wondering about the adapter binaries.

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Why aren't we building the adapter(s) from source anymore?

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Didn't think there was much advantage. The artifact we would get out would be what's checked in here, so why spend needless CPU time building them?

@rylev rylev merged commit bdea058 into main Jun 21, 2023
@rylev rylev deleted the wasmtime10 branch June 21, 2023 08:32
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ants